More News On Upcoming Children Of Bodom Album, Warmen Set Album Release Date

Band Photo: Children of Bodom (?)
Children of Bodom fansite, Scythes-of-Bodom.com, reveals that in a recent interview with Finnish music magazine Soundi, frontman, Alexi Laiho, revealed that some completely new influences can be heard on the band's upcoming album, "Are You Dead Yet?" He said that the album will be even more straight-forward than their last album, "Hate Crew Deathroll" and that it will have some industrial elements on it in addition to the trademark CoB sound.
In related news, further details regarding keyboardist, Janne Warmen's side project, have been revealed. The third full-length album by Warmen will be called "Accept the Fact" and will hit stores July 6th. On June 8th, a single called "Somebody's Watching Me" will provide us a little preview of the album. It comes with a bonus track called "Faithful Eyes," which can't be found on the album itself. The album will feature guest appearances by Alexi Laiho and Stratovarius' Timo Kotipelto, among others.
